WALTERBORO:     Claude M. Gibson Jr., beloved husband of Laurie Mitchell Gibson, passed away Monday evening, November 3, 2025 at the Colleton Medical Center with his wife, and his devoted caregiver Nikki Ferguson, by his side.  He was 57.

Claude was born in Savannah, GA December 4, 1967 a son of Shirley LeGrand Gibson and the late Claude M. Gibson Sr.   At an early age, he learned the value of hard work, and was employed with various companies and businesses over the years, before establishing  his own company, Gibson Trucking Inc.  He was devoted to it, and ensured that every goal was met to achieve its success.  In 2008, a tragic accident while camping with his family left Claude paralyzed.  Throughout the years since then, he always maintained a positive outlook on life, and never let his disability hold him back.  In fact, many people thought it made him stronger, and he was an inspiration to everyone he met.  He still spent time outdoors hunting and camping but the most important thing to him was the time he spent with his parents, his wife, his children and grandchildren.  They were his never ending source of joy and support.

In addition to his mother and his wife, Claude is survived by his children Nadia Canady (Ashton), and Claude M. Gibson III (Jalyn).  He leaves behind his cherished grandchildren Jaxson, Gracelyn and Blythe, as well as his devoted caregiver Nikki Ferguson, who promised him that she would not quit caring for him until he left this world.  In addition to his father, he was preceded in death by his sister Jannet Marie Gibson.
